summaryrefslogtreecommitdiffstats
path: root/target-i386
Commit message (Expand)AuthorAgeFilesLines
* target-*: Don't redefine cpu_exec()Peter Crosthwaite2016-06-291-2/+0Star
* Merge remote-tracking branch 'remotes/stefanha/tags/tracing-pull-request' int...Peter Maydell2016-06-201-0/+1
|\
| * exec: [tcg] Track which vCPU is performing translation and executionLluís Vilanova2016-06-201-0/+1
* | coccinelle: Remove unnecessary variables for function return valueEduardo Habkost2016-06-202-11/+4Star
* | error: Remove unnecessary local_err variablesEduardo Habkost2016-06-201-3/+1Star
|/
* target-i386: kvm: cache KVM_GET_SUPPORTED_CPUID dataChao Peng2016-06-161-2/+7
* os-posix: include sys/mman.hPaolo Bonzini2016-06-161-1/+0Star
* target-i386: Consolidate calls of object_property_parse() in x86_cpu_parse_fe...Eduardo Habkost2016-06-141-29/+45
* target-i386: Use cpu_generic_init() in cpu_x86_init()Igor Mammedov2016-06-141-19/+1Star
* target-i386: Move xcc->kvm_required check to realize timeIgor Mammedov2016-06-141-8/+16
* target-i386: Remove assert(kvm_enabled()) from host_x86_cpu_initfn()Eduardo Habkost2016-06-141-5/+6
* target-i386: Move features logic that requires CPUState to realize timeIgor Mammedov2016-06-141-18/+26
* target-i386: Remove xlevel & hv-spinlocks option fixupsEduardo Habkost2016-06-141-35/+1Star
* target-i386: Implement CPUID[0xB] (Extended Topology Enumeration)Radim Krčmář2016-06-142-0/+40
* target-i386: add Skylake-Client cpu modelEduardo Habkost2016-06-141-0/+45
* target-i386: Move user-mode exception actions out of user-exec.cPeter Maydell2016-06-091-0/+2
* target-i386: Add comment about do_interrupt_user() next_eip argumentPeter Maydell2016-06-091-1/+5
* cpu-exec: Rename cpu_resume_from_signal() to cpu_loop_exit_noexc()Peter Maydell2016-06-091-1/+1
* target-*: dfilter support for in_asmRichard Henderson2016-06-051-1/+2
* memory: split memory_region_from_host from qemu_ram_addr_from_hostPaolo Bonzini2016-05-291-2/+4
* target-i386: kvm: Eliminate kvm_msr_entry_set()Eduardo Habkost2016-05-241-9/+3Star
* target-i386: kvm: Simplify MSR setting functionsEduardo Habkost2016-05-241-21/+6Star
* target-i386: kvm: Simplify MSR array constructionEduardo Habkost2016-05-241-151/+140Star
* target-i386: kvm: Increase MSR_BUF_SIZEEduardo Habkost2016-05-241-2/+3
* target-i386: kvm: Allocate kvm_msrs struct once per VCPUEduardo Habkost2016-05-242-18/+23
* target-i386: Call cpu_exec_init() on realizeEduardo Habkost2016-05-241-1/+2
* target-i386: Move TCG initialization to realize timeEduardo Habkost2016-05-241-5/+4Star
* target-i386: Move TCG initialization check to tcg_x86_init()Eduardo Habkost2016-05-242-3/+7
* cpu: Eliminate cpudef_init(), cpudef_setup()Eduardo Habkost2016-05-242-6/+0Star
* target-i386: Set constant model_id for qemu64/qemu32/athlonEduardo Habkost2016-05-241-20/+3Star
* target-i386: kvm: Use X86XSaveArea struct for xsave save/loadEduardo Habkost2016-05-231-40/+38Star
* target-i386: Use xsave structs for ext_save_areaEduardo Habkost2016-05-231-7/+14
* target-i386: Define structs for layout of xsave areaEduardo Habkost2016-05-232-0/+118
* target-i386: key sfence availability on CPUID_SSE, not CPUID_SSE2Paolo Bonzini2016-05-231-0/+5
* cpu: move exec-all.h inclusion out of cpu.hPaolo Bonzini2016-05-1914-2/+15
* qemu-common: push cpu.h inclusion out of qemu-common.hPaolo Bonzini2016-05-194-1/+5
* hw: cannot include hw/hw.h from user emulationPaolo Bonzini2016-05-191-1/+1
* hw: move CPU state serialization to migration/cpu.hPaolo Bonzini2016-05-191-0/+1
* apic: move target-dependent definitions to cpu.hPaolo Bonzini2016-05-191-0/+7
* target-i386: make cpu-qom.h not target specificPaolo Bonzini2016-05-192-97/+98
* cpu: make cpu-qom.h only include-able from cpu.hPaolo Bonzini2016-05-191-1/+0Star
* Fix some typos found by codespellStefan Weil2016-05-182-2/+2
* tcg: Allow goto_tb to any target PC in user modeSergey Fedorov2016-05-131-9/+14
* tcg: Clean up direct block chaining safety checksSergey Fedorov2016-05-131-1/+1
* tb: consistently use uint32_t for tb->flagsEmilio G. Cota2016-05-132-2/+2
* event-notifier: Add "is_external" parameterFam Zheng2016-04-221-3/+3
* target-i386: Set AMD alias bits after filtering CPUID dataEduardo Habkost2016-04-181-8/+8
* target-i386: check for PKU even for non-writable pagesPaolo Bonzini2016-04-081-8/+10
* target-i386: assert that KVM_GET/SET_MSRS can set all requested MSRsPaolo Bonzini2016-04-051-4/+30
* target-i386: do not pass MSR_TSC_AUX to KVM ioctls if CPUID bit is not setPaolo Bonzini2016-04-051-0/+3